Product Overview
The OPTEASE™ Retrievable Vena Cava Filter is designed for both temporary and permanent use, offering flexibility in patient care. It can be removed up to 12 days post-implantation and is engineered to minimize risks associated with retrievable filters.

Design Features
  • Low Profile Delivery System: Utilizes a 6F delivery system with six potential access points, providing versatility in placement.
  • Closed Cage Design: Aims to prevent caval perforation and strut embolization, reducing the risk of complications.
  • Fixation Barbs: Designed to minimize migration and maintain clot capture efficiency.
  • Dual Prong Caudal Hook: Facilitates easier snare capture for retrieval.
  • Side Struts: Self-centering upon insertion to reduce tilting and enhance stability.

FDA Safety Communication
In 2014, the FDA highlighted concerns about adverse events with vena cava filters, including filter embolization, IVC penetration, and filter migration. The OPTEASE™ filter addresses these issues with a design that supports safe retrieval and low complication rates.

Clinical Evidence
The PROOF study demonstrated the safety and efficacy of the OPTEASE™ filter, with fewer than 1% of patients experiencing migration or new thrombus formation. The study reported no cases of symptomatic pulmonary embolism, caval perforation, or strut embolization.

Design Specifications Fixation Barbs • Minimize risk of migration to maintain clot capture efficiency • "Ski Barb" design resists cranial migration which can lead to serious complications • Location at upper pole allows for earlier wall apposition when placed via femoral access Back to Performance Page

Design Specifications Closed Cage Design Fully connected structure designed to eliminate the risk of caval perforation by needle-like arms Designed to eliminate strut embolization after fracture of a single strut segment Eliminates risk of struts becoming entangled, thereby leaving a gap between struts Back to Performance Page
